Why team-based hiring changes screening

For years, recruiting was often built around relatively stable job descriptions and clearer functional ladders. But many organizations now work through cross-functional teams, shorter project cycles, and decentralized decision-making. That shift changes screening in a practical way: the recruiter is no longer screening only for title alignment or years of experience. They are screening for whether someone can contribute inside a specific team setup.

That is the most useful lesson from the team-based HR discussion in the reference material. The hiring question is not just, “Can this person do the job?” It is also, “Can this person operate well in a team that moves quickly, shares ownership, and may change shape over time?”

In day-to-day recruiting work, that means:

  • Job titles become less precise signals than before.
  • Relevant experience may span multiple functions or projects.
  • Hiring managers may describe success in terms of collaboration, adaptability, and decision speed.
  • Screening criteria need to separate must-have capability from nice-to-have background.
  • Recruiters need a structured way to compare candidates against a broader team context.

Without that structure, even experienced recruiters can end up relying too much on surface familiarity. Candidate ai can help here, but only when the workflow captures the real hiring context instead of reducing everything to keyword matching.

What candidate ai means in practical recruiting

In real hiring operations, candidate ai refers to software that helps recruiting teams interpret applicant information and compare it with job-related criteria. That can include resume parsing, skills extraction, knockout-question handling, questionnaire review, ranking, and prioritization for recruiter follow-up.

The critical distinction is simple: the system recommends and organizes, while people decide. That distinction becomes even more important in team-based hiring, where soft context and project fit can matter alongside technical qualification.

What AI screening usually evaluates well

  • Required skills tied directly to the role
  • Relevant experience by function, industry, seniority, or project type
  • Knockout questions such as authorization, licenses, or schedule constraints
  • Structured application data from forms and questionnaires
  • Comparable evidence that helps rank applicants for review

What it evaluates less perfectly is nuanced team contribution. The more fluid the role, the more important it is that recruiters review the reasoning behind any ranking. A candidate who has moved across functions or worked in adaptive teams may be stronger than a narrow title match suggests.

Practical takeaway: The best use of candidate ai is to create a better first-pass review queue for recruiters, not to flatten complex hiring decisions into a single score.

How automated candidate screening works step by step

Most automated candidate screening workflows follow a familiar pattern. Understanding that pattern helps recruiters separate useful systems from black-box claims.

  1. Application or sourcing intake: The system receives resumes, LinkedIn profile information, application forms, knockout answers, and screening responses.
  2. Parsing and extraction: Resume content is converted into structured data such as titles, dates, certifications, locations, and skill clusters.
  3. Criteria mapping: The system compares that information against required and preferred qualifications.
  4. Skills calibration: Related terms are normalized so the process is not limited to exact keyword matches.
  5. Ranking or grouping: Candidates are prioritized for recruiter review, often with explanations.
  6. Human review and override: A recruiter validates the shortlist before advancing or rejecting anyone.

That sequence matters because efficient candidate screening with ai depends on more than technology. It depends on disciplined intake and clear criteria.

Limits, risks, and where human review is essential

AI screening is useful, but it is not self-correcting. If the job criteria are weak, the ranking will be weak. If the role is broad, the system may overweight visible signals and miss adaptable candidates with less conventional resumes.

This is especially relevant in the kind of team-based environment described earlier. The reference article stressed team dynamics, flexibility, and the limits of evaluating people only by functional fit. That same warning applies here. Recruiters should not assume that a strong score automatically means strong contribution inside a decentralized or cross-functional team.

Human-in-the-loop checkpoints

  • Review the top-ranked group before outreach or rejection moves forward.
  • Spot-check lower-ranked candidates for false negatives.
  • Make sure knockout questions are necessary and job-related.
  • Check whether broad titles or unusual career paths are being misread.
  • Document overrides when recruiter judgment differs from the system output.

Fairness and compliance considerations

Recruiters should also think about fairness, candidate notice, and auditability. Good governance is not separate from good recruiting. In many organizations, the same systems that support speed also need to support transparency.

  • Fairness: Check whether the logic may disadvantage protected groups.
  • Notice: Tell candidates when AI-supported screening is part of the process where required or appropriate.
  • Opt-out handling: Define whether an alternate review path exists.
  • Audit trails: Keep records of criteria, rankings, reviewer actions, and overrides.
  • Human decision-making: Keep final decisions with recruiters and hiring stakeholders.

How to implement efficient candidate screening with ai

The best implementation starts with workflow design, not software enthusiasm. In practice, I have found that teams get better results when they treat AI screening as a hiring-calibration project first.

1. Separate fixed requirements from team-context requirements

Start with the non-negotiables such as licenses, languages, authorization, systems knowledge, or location constraints. Then define the team-context requirements separately: collaboration style, project pace, stakeholder exposure, or cross-functional work. This mirrors the reference article's broader point that organizations are hiring into team environments, not just boxes on an org chart.

2. Rebuild intake conversations with hiring managers

Ask what the team actually needs to accomplish, not just what the title says. Who leads the work? How quickly do priorities shift? What kind of communicator succeeds in that environment? Better intake improves both recruiter judgment and candidate ai output.

3. Standardize the evidence you want to see

Define how the system should recognize relevant experience. In flexible roles, years in title may matter less than examples of ownership, project variety, or work across teams.

5. Pilot on one role family

Choose a repeatable hiring area such as operations, support, sales, healthcare, or software. Compare recruiter-led shortlists with AI-prioritized ones. Look closely at misses involving transferable experience or broad team roles.

6. Measure quality, not just speed

Time saved matters, but so do shortlist quality, override rates, hiring manager trust, and candidate experience. Efficient candidate screening with ai should make the process more reliable, not just faster.

What to look for in software and workflow design

When evaluating AI-supported screening, the main question is whether the workflow helps recruiters handle complexity without losing control.

Evaluation areaWhat good looks likeWhy it matters
Parsing qualityAccurate extraction of titles, dates, certifications, and skillsWeak parsing creates weak rankings
Criteria transparencyClear view of what the system is usingSupports defensible screening
Skills calibrationRecognition of related and adjacent experienceHelps with flexible team-based roles
ExplanationsVisible reasons for prioritizationImproves recruiter review and manager alignment
Workflow controlsHuman approval before final status changesPrevents over-automation
Upstream sourcing supportSmooth handoff from outreach to resume collectionImproves screening readiness
Compliance supportAudit logs, notices, and override documentationReduces governance risk

That checklist is especially useful when the role sits inside a network of teams rather than a static hierarchy. In those environments, the best system is not the one with the loudest AI claims. It is the one that gives recruiters structured evidence while preserving context.

Common mistakes recruiters make

  • Treating AI ranking as a final answer: It is a prioritization tool, not a hiring authority.
  • Using vague job intake: Broad roles need more calibration, not less.
  • Overvaluing exact title matches: Team-based work often rewards adjacent experience.
  • Ignoring the upstream funnel: A poor handoff from sourcing to resume review weakens screening quality.
  • Skipping human spot checks: False negatives are common when roles are fluid.
  • Forgetting team context: Skills alone do not explain contribution in agile, decentralized environments.

FAQ

What is candidate ai in recruiting?

Candidate ai refers to software that helps recruiters parse applicant information, compare it with role criteria, and prioritize candidates for review. It supports recruiting decisions but should not replace them.

How does automated candidate screening work?

It typically collects application data, structures resume information, compares candidates with job requirements, ranks or groups profiles, and then sends those results to recruiters for human review.

Why is AI screening more useful in team-based hiring?

Because many roles now sit inside flexible, cross-functional teams. Recruiters need a way to compare candidates consistently even when job titles are broad and hiring managers care about adaptability as well as qualifications.

Can AI determine team fit on its own?

No. It can help organize evidence and identify relevant experience, but recruiters and hiring managers still need to judge communication style, context, stakeholder fit, and project readiness.

Where does LinkedIn outreach automation fit into screening?

It fits upstream. Outreach automation can help engage candidates, answer basic questions, and collect resumes so recruiters receive a cleaner screening queue. Final qualification still happens after resume review.

Is efficient candidate screening with ai mainly about speed?

No. Speed is part of the value, but consistency, transparency, and better shortlist quality are just as important.

What should recruiters ask before adopting AI screening?

They should ask what data is analyzed, how related skills are mapped, whether explanations are visible, how human review works, and how the process handles fairness and auditability.
